Georgetown Woman Dead, 4 Injured in Head-On Bridgeville Crash

One person is dead and State Police say another four are injured from a head-on collision east of Bridgeville Saturday.

Investigators say 18-year-old Justin Fuller, of Mount Airy Maryland, was driving his Dodge Durango westbound on Seashore Highway around 11 a.m., when, for an unknown reason, he crossed into oncoming traffic, hitting a pick-up truck.

Troopers say a passenger in that pick-up truck, 53-year-old Carolyn Tallent of Georgetown, was pronounced dead at the scene.

Police say her husband, 49-year-old Frank Tallent, was behind the wheel of the pick-up. He's listed in critical condition at Christiana Medical Center.

Police say Fuller and a passenger were transported to Milford Memorial Hospital where they were treated and released.

Fuller's second passenger is reported in critical condition at Christiana.

Police say Route 404 was closed between Oak Road and Chaplins Chapel Road for about four hours after the crash.
